This classic party food is simple to make and a crowd pleaser. Crescent roll dough is wrapped around Lil Smokies and brushed with a savory buttery glaze and then baked to perfection. Serve hot and fresh with your favorite dippers!
Preheat the oven to 375°F. Line 2 baking sheets with parchment paper and set aside.
Pat the Lil Smokies dry with a paper towel.
Unroll the crescent roll dough and cut each triangle into 3 long triangles.
Place 1 Lil Smokie at the end of one of the triangles and wrap it up like a crescent roll.
Place the wrapped smokies on the baking sheet. Repeat these steps with the other crescent roll dough. Make sure the wrapped smokies do not touch each other on the baking sheet.
In a small bowl, stir together melted butter, dried onion, Dijon mustard, poppy seeds, sesame seeds, Worcestershire sauce and garlic powder.
Brush the glaze all over the top of the wrapped crescents and make sure to use all of it.
Bake in the oven for 11 to 12 minutes until lightly golden brown.
Let cool for a few minutes and then serve immediately.
